Striking portrait of Hoover as secretary of commerce

Distinguished vintage matte-finish 4.5 x 6.5 half-length portrait of Hoover by noted southwestern photographer T. Harmon Parkhurst in its original 7.25 x 9.5 mat, signed and inscribed on the mat in black ink, “To Mrs. Vollmer, With kind regards of Herbert Hoover.” In fine condition, with some mild silvering to dark areas of the image. Accompanied by the original period frame. Parkhurst most likely took this photo during Hoover’s trip to Santa Fe from November 9 to 24, 1922, during which he helped finalize the Colorado River Compact; helping to confirm this is a group photo from the meetings owned by the Hoover Presidential Library, also taken by Parkhurst.
